I don't dislike the idea, but I think you'd need to change the behavior of c4 for just this round to have a minimum timer of 20 seconds or so, it should only be able to happen on certain maps, and there should be some mechanic to make the round progressively more lethal as time goes on. I'm also a bit concerned that this round will likely result in a lot of ties from everyone dying simultaneously.
- 20 second timer means there isn't 75 seconds of waiting at the start of the round until people start dying, that becomes 50 seconds instead (still pretty long). It also means that once the killing slows down, it's not 45 seconds of waiting between each kill attempt. I understand that you'd be planting c4 more than once every 45 seconds, but 45 seconds between the arming and the detonation feels way too long for a fun round.
- There are some maps where this round will simply not be fun. A few that come to mind are crummy cradle and 67th way.
- Once enough people die, the killing is going to slow down dramatically. There needs to be some way to close out the round, or this is always going to end very slowly. Could be something simple like c4 radius gradually getting larger, or something more complicated like dead players coming back as zombies to hunt down survivors. That one isn't exactly thematic, but it would work.
I think this concept is pretty fun, but there are so many question marks in the execution that I don't really see it working out.
